pub struct HelicalChirality {
pub backbone_atoms: Vec<usize>,
pub configuration: Option<String>,
pub helix_type: String,
pub dihedral_angle: Option<f64>,
}Expand description
Helical chirality (M/P) detected in helicenes, allenes with extended conjugation, or metallocenes with non-coplanar rings.
Fields§
§backbone_atoms: Vec<usize>Atom indices that form the helical backbone.
configuration: Option<String>Configuration: “M” (minus, left-handed) or “P” (plus, right-handed).
helix_type: StringType: “helicene”, “allene”, “metallocene”.
dihedral_angle: Option<f64>Dihedral angle of the helix (degrees).
